Doctor Who The Invisible Enemy TV Story

The Invisible Enemy Synopsis

When The Doctor answers a distress call from a shuttle crew who have been infected with an intelligent virus, he too becomes contaminated. The only solution is to create clones of The Doctor and his companion Leela (Louise Jameson) to enter his body and fight the virus.

Story Order

  • Story 93 from Doctor Who
  • Story 2 of 6 from Season 15

Episodes

Saturday
1st October 1977
6:15PM
BBC 1 (23 mins)

Doctor Who - The Invisible Enemy - Part One

Deep space, 5000 AD. An Earth supply shuttle is infected by a strange sentient space-born virus.

Saturday
8th October 1977
6:05PM
BBC 1 (25 mins)

Doctor Who - The Invisible Enemy - Part Two

Leela and Lowe take the Doctor to the Bi-Al Foundation for help.

Saturday
15th October 1977
6:10PM
BBC 1 (23 mins)

Doctor Who - The Invisible Enemy - Part Three

Miniaturized clones of the Doctor and Leela are injected into his brain.

Saturday
22nd October 1977
6:10PM
BBC 1 (21 mins)

Doctor Who - The Invisible Enemy - Part Four

The Nucleus, now grown to human size, is determined to spawn and take over the Galaxy.

The Invisible Enemy

Credits
  • Writer Bob Baker
  • Writer Dave Martin
  • Director Derrick Goodwin
  • Producer Graham Williams
  • Script Editor Robert Holmes
  • Doctor Who Tom Baker
  • Leela Louise Jameson
  • Lowe Michael Sheard
  • Safran Brian Grellis
  • Meeker Edmund Pegge
  • Silvey Jay Neill
  • Crewman Anthony Rowlands
  • Nucleus Voice John Leeson
  • Professor Marius Frederick Jaeger
  • Parsons Roy Herrick
  • Marius' Nurse Elizabeth Norman
  • Reception Nurse Nell Curran
  • Voice of K-9 John Leeson
  • Opthalmologist Jim McManus
  • Cruikshank Roderick Smith
  • Hedges Kenneth Waller
  • Medic Pat Gorman
  • Nucleus John Scott Martin
